Nocturnal gibberellin biosynthesis is carbon dependent and adjusts leaf expansion rates to variable conditions.
Plant physiology - 25 Feb 2021
Prasetyaningrum Putri, Mariotti Lorenzo, Valeri Maria Cristina, Novi Giacomo, Dhondt Stijn, Inzé Dirk, Perata Pierdomenico, van Veen Hans
Abstract excerpt
Optimal plant growth performance requires that the presence and action of growth signals, such as gibberellins (GAs), are coordinated with the availability of photo-assimilates. Here, we studied the links between GA biosynthesis and carbon availability, and the subsequent effects on growth. We established that carbon availability, light and dark cues, and the circadian clock ensure the timing and magnitude of GA...
